A bit of googling shows that every coach hired by NYJ going back to Parcells was an assistant or coordinator. Even Sexy Rexy and Herm The Germ were only coordinators when hired. Parcells was the last person with NFL head coaching experience they hired, and "Parcells' record as the team's head coach was 29-19-0, making him the most successful head coach in New York Jets history". Guess they didn't want more of that?

To me it feels the Jete have been getting reruns of the Mayo experience. Not sure why this is. Maybe no desirable ex-HC wants to work for Woody. We know BB didn't. Or maybe they understand the depth of the cultural suckage and don't want to risk their career.

Pretty much none of those ex-NYJ coaches have gone on to greatness. Bowles was Arians' assistant during the Brady Super Bowl and after Arians moved on he been pretty mediocre, IMO.
